Mushfiqur Rahim starts practice

Sports Reporter :
Prolific batsman Mushfiqur Rahim started practice at the garage in his house on Wednesday. Mushfiqur Rahim practised with his bat and tennis ball. Then he was busy with wicketkeeping for some time. The duration time of his batting practice was two minutes and 12 seconds. Rest of the time Mushfiqur Rahim spent in wicketkeeping.
Before the Eid-ul-Fitr, some senior cricketers sought permission from Bangladesh Cricket Board (BCB) to practice in the field. They urged BCB to permit them to engage in solo practice. After the Eid-ul-Fitr, BCB gave them permission to practice at the Sher-e-Bangla National Cricket Stadium in the city’s Mirpur. But as Mirpur was Red Zone, It was a tough task to practice there and no cricketer was busy in his practice there.
Earlier, Mashrafe Bin Mortaza, Mahmudullah Riyad took part on a Facebook chat with Tamim Iqbal. They said, ” If Mushfiqur Rahim couldn’t practice for some days, Mushfiqur would die.” It was a humour.
They also said, ” Mushfiqur Rahim spent a lot of time in practice. If he couldn’t carry on his practice, he will become impatient.”
Mushfiqur Rahim really became annoyed without practice. He spent his time by physical exercise to keep his fitness.
